Responsibilities:
  • Accurately pick products from warehouse shelves according to order lists.
  • Pack items carefully into appropriate shipping containers, ensuring product protection.
  • Use RF scanners and other warehouse equipment to track inventory and manage orders.
  • Maintain a clean and organized work area to promote efficiency and safety.
  • Adhere to all company policies and procedures, especially those related to safety.
  • Meet or exceed picking and packing productivity targets.
  • Assist with inventory counts and stock replenishment as needed.
  • Understand and follow all safety guidelines and protocols.

Qualifications:
  • Previous experience in a warehouse or order picking role is a plus, but not required.
  • Ability to perform physical tasks, including significant Lifting (up to 50 lbs repetitively).
  • Basic reading and comprehension skills.
  • Familiarity with RF scanners and warehouse management systems is beneficial.
  • Willingness to wear required PPE, including safety vests and gloves.
  • Must be able to stand, walk, bend, and reach for extended periods.
  • Strong work ethic and a commitment to Safety.
